In this exclusive video below, Diego Zuluaga, policy analyst at Washington-based US think tank The CATO Institute outlined his take on how the push for global transparency needs to be monitored, suggesting that calls for public beneficial ownership registers could be damaging and even potentially life-threatening to some individuals.

Zuluaga - a guest panelist at the Bahamas Financial Services Board annual International Business & Finance Summit (IBFS) - also spoke to International Investment about the need for and future look of offshore financial centres and how The Bahamas sits within this ever-evolving world.
